Question 6, 2.8.17 Let f(x)=x^(2)-11 and g(x)=15-x. Perform the composition or operation indicated. ((f)/(g))(5)

Answers

Answer 1

The value of the composition or operation indicated ((f)/(g))(5), when f(x)=x^(2)-11 and g(x)=15-x is 7/5.

The given functions are as follows:

f(x) = x² - 11

g(x) = 15 - x

To find the composition of f(x) and g(x) where x = 5, we need to perform (f/g)(5).

Therefore,

(f/g)(5) = f(5) / g(5)

Now, f(5) = 5² - 11 = 14, and g(5) = 15 - 5 = 10

Therefore,

(f/g)(5) = f(5) / g(5) = 14 / 10 = 7 / 5

Thus, the value of ((f)/(g))(5) is 7/5.

a five-card hand is dealt at random from a standard deck. What is the probability that the hand contains exactly two black cards

Answers

Using the principle of binomial probability, the probability of having exactly two black cards is 0.3125

Probability of having a black card = 26/52 = 1/2

Using the binomial probability relation :

P(x = x) = nCx * p^x * q^(n-x) p = probability of success = 1/2 = 0.5Number of picks, n = 5q = 1 - p = 0.5 x = 2

Hence,

P(x = 2) = 5C2 × 0.5² × 0.5³

P(x = 2) = 10 × 0.25 × 0.125

P(x = 2) = 0.3125

Hence. Probability of having exactly 2 black cards is 0.3125

Lyle and Shaun open savings accounts at the same time. Lyle deposits $100 initially and adds $20 per week. Shaun deposits $500 initially and adds $10 per week. Lyle wants to know when he will have the same amount in his savings account as Shaun.
Part A: Write two equations to represent the amounts of money Lyle and Shaun have in their accounts
f(x=
g(x)=
Part B: to solve the system you will make f(x)=g(x)

Answers

A. The equations for the amounts of money Lyle and Shaun have in their accounts are represented as:

f(x) = 20x + 100

g(x) = 10x + 500

B. When f(x) = g(x), x = 40.

How to Write the Equation of a System?

A linear equation can be written in slope-intercept form y = mx + b. Here, the value of m is the unit rate or slope, while the value of b is its y-intercept or initial value.

Part A:

Equation for Lyle:

y-intercept / initial value (b) = $100

Slope / unit rate (m) = $20

To write the equation, substitute m = 20 and b = 100 into f(x) = mx + b:

f(x) = 20x + 100.

Equation for Lyle:

y-intercept / initial value (b) = $500

Slope / unit rate (m) = $10

To write the equation, substitute m = 10 and b = 500 into g(x) = mx + b:

g(x) = 10x + 500.

Part B: To solve the system, we would do the following:

20x + 100 = 10x + 500

20x - 10x = -100 + 500

10x = 400

x = 400/10

x = 40
